Fleet Telematics Systems Market, Segmentation by Type
The Fleet Telematics Systems Market by type is primarily divided into Aftermarket and OEM solutions, each catering to different deployment and customization requirements. Growing connectivity across commercial vehicles, supported by 5G networks and IoT integration, is enhancing data accuracy, safety, and operational transparency. This segmentation reflects the evolution of fleet telematics from optional tools to essential components of modern logistics management.
Aftermarket
Aftermarket telematics systems dominate due to their flexibility, cost-effectiveness, and ease of installation across mixed fleets. They are widely adopted by small and mid-sized fleet operators seeking real-time vehicle tracking and performance analytics without major upfront investments. Integration with cloud-based dashboards and mobile apps enhances decision-making and route optimization.
OEM
OEM telematics systems are pre-installed by vehicle manufacturers, offering seamless integration with in-built sensors and control units. They deliver superior accuracy, reliability, and compliance with regulatory standards related to emissions, driver safety, and maintenance monitoring. The rising trend of connected vehicles and embedded telematics modules is propelling OEM adoption across global markets.
Fleet Telematics Systems Market, Segmentation by Component
Segmentation by component reflects how active and passive systems contribute to fleet monitoring efficiency. The growing focus on predictive analytics and real-time data processing is transforming the landscape of telematics hardware and software architecture.
Active
Active components include sensors and communication devices that transmit data continuously for live monitoring. These systems enable real-time diagnostics, location tracking, and driver behavior analysis. Their integration with AI-powered fleet management platforms is optimizing performance and safety through automated alerts and route corrections.
Passive
Passive components collect data for later retrieval and analysis, making them suitable for fleets operating in remote or low-connectivity environments. They provide detailed post-trip reports that help identify fuel inefficiencies, idle time, and maintenance trends. Their cost advantage and reliability make them valuable for compliance reporting and long-haul logistics tracking.
Fleet Telematics Systems Market, Segmentation by Application
The application-based segmentation of the fleet telematics market demonstrates the versatility of these systems across various operational domains. The data generated by telematics supports fleet optimization, cost reduction, driver safety, and insurance risk management across commercial and industrial sectors.
Fleet Management
Fleet management applications account for a major share, enabling centralized control over vehicle scheduling, fuel usage, and maintenance planning. The integration of real-time analytics and predictive maintenance helps companies reduce downtime and extend vehicle lifespan. Adoption is particularly strong in logistics, transportation, and construction industries.
Vehicle Tracking
Vehicle tracking remains a core telematics function, providing precise location data through GPS and cellular connectivity. Fleet operators utilize tracking to improve route efficiency, delivery accuracy, and asset security. The proliferation of IoT-enabled trackers is enhancing visibility across global supply chains.
Telematics Insurance
Telematics insurance leverages data collected from onboard systems to calculate risk-based premiums. Usage-based insurance (UBI) models, driven by driver behavior analytics and mileage tracking, are becoming popular among commercial fleets. Insurers increasingly rely on real-time telematics data to reward safe driving and minimize fraudulent claims.
Remote Diagnostics
Remote diagnostics applications provide insights into engine performance, fault codes, and maintenance needs. Fleet owners benefit from early detection of mechanical issues, reducing repair costs and improving operational uptime. Integration with AI-driven maintenance scheduling is enhancing predictive service capabilities.
Driver Behavior Monitoring
Driver behavior monitoring systems track parameters such as acceleration, braking, speed, and rest periods. This helps improve driver performance, safety compliance, and fuel economy. Companies are adopting these systems to reduce accidents and ensure compliance with transportation safety regulations.
Fleet Telematics Systems Market, Segmentation by Geography
In this report, the Fleet Telematics Systems Market has been segmented by Geography into five regions: North America, Europe, Asia Pacific, Middle East and Africa and Latin America.
Regions and Countries Analyzed in this Report
North America
North America leads the global fleet telematics systems market, driven by early adoption of connected vehicle technologies and regulatory support for fleet safety and emissions monitoring. The U.S. accounts for a major share, supported by large commercial vehicle fleets and advanced cloud-based fleet management solutions.
Europe
Europe exhibits strong growth due to stringent road safety and carbon emission standards. The EU’s focus on intelligent transport systems (ITS) and mandatory eCall installation has accelerated telematics adoption. Companies are investing in integrated telematics-insurance ecosystems for both passenger and commercial fleets.
Asia Pacific
Asia Pacific is the fastest-growing region, supported by rapid expansion of logistics and e-commerce sectors. China, Japan, and India are leading adopters of GPS-enabled fleet monitoring solutions. Government-backed initiatives for smart mobility and vehicle tracking compliance are driving large-scale market expansion.
Middle East & Africa
Middle East & Africa are experiencing steady growth with increasing adoption of telematics in logistics, oil transport, and commercial fleets. Investments in smart infrastructure and transport digitization are promoting integration of telematics platforms for regional connectivity improvement.
Latin America
Latin America is witnessing growing deployment of fleet telematics systems for route optimization, safety monitoring, and theft prevention. Brazil and Mexico are major markets, supported by regulatory mandates for vehicle tracking in public and private fleets.

Data Security Concerns - Data security concerns represent a significant aspect of the Global Fleet Telematics Systems Market, as the proliferation of connected vehicles and the collection of sensitive data introduce potential vulnerabilities. With fleet telematics systems continuously gathering and transmitting data on vehicle location, performance, and driver behavior, ensuring the confidentiality, integrity, and availability of this information is paramount. The risk of unauthorized access, data breaches, and cyber-attacks underscores the importance of robust cybersecurity measures across the telematics ecosystem.
Fleet operators and telematics service providers face the challenge of safeguarding data against various threats, including hacking attempts, malware infections, and insider breaches. Vulnerabilities in telematics hardware, software, and communication networks pose potential entry points for malicious actors seeking to exploit sensitive information for illicit purposes. Consequently, industry stakeholders must implement comprehensive security protocols, encryption techniques, and access controls to mitigate these risks and protect data privacy.

Integration with Other Technologies - The integration of fleet telematics systems with other advanced technologies is reshaping the landscape of fleet management and driving innovation across various industries. One significant area of integration is with Internet of Things (IoT) devices, which enable the seamless connectivity of vehicles with a network of sensors and smart devices. By leveraging IoT capabilities, fleet telematics systems can access real-time data on vehicle performance, environmental conditions, and driver behavior, facilitating proactive maintenance, route optimization, and fuel efficiency enhancements.
Moreover, the convergence of fleet telematics with artificial intelligence (AI) and machine learning technologies empowers operators to extract actionable insights from vast volumes of data collected from fleet operations. AI-driven analytics enable predictive maintenance, anomaly detection, and driver behavior analysis, enabling fleet managers to identify trends, mitigate risks, and optimize operational efficiency. Additionally, the integration of telematics systems with advanced safety features such as collision avoidance systems, lane departure warnings, and driver fatigue detection enhances vehicle safety and reduces the risk of accidents on the road.
